> A function which takes its argument by ref is specifically
> intended to mutate its argument, otherwise it wouldn't take the
> argument by
> ref. Allowing such a parameter to be passed an rvalue makes it
> so that the
> function does not do what it's intended to do and will easily
> cause bugs.
>
A function can use ref argument for performance reasons.
> C++ made it so that const& would accept rvalues with the idea
> that if it were
> const, then you obviously didn't want to mutate the argument,
> and you could
> then use it as a means to avoid unnecessary copies. But with
> how restrictive
> const is in D, we really should have a means of declaring a
> function parameter
> such that it's intended to avoid unnecessary copies but isn't
> necessarily
> const and is obviously not intended to mutate the original
> (though as long as
> the parameter isn't const, mutation is obviously still a
> possibility, and
> const is required to guarantee that that doesn't happen -
> _that_ could be a
> const-related bug). But allowing ref functions to accept
> rvalues is an
> incredibly bad idea, because it's mixing two very different
> idioms - taking an
> argument by ref in order to mutate that argument and possibly
> taking an
> argument by ref in order to avoid a copy. It never makes sense
> to take an
> rvalue by ref. rvalue arguments need to use moves, not ref.
